Finance Review — Vellan Systems, Q3. The Orbita product line is underpriced against margin targets. Gross margin sits at 31% versus the 38% floor. Mid-tier SKUs drive the gap; entry SKUs are fine. Recommendation: raise Orbita Mid list price 6% effective next quarter, hold discounting authority at regional level. Sales leads should model pipeline impact by Friday. No exceptions without sign-off from Marta Hellwig. The rationale ties directly to next year's positioning, summarized below.

confidential, kagep-kahof: Druokax Systems plans to lower the Ulaath list price by 53 percent in March.

Handover: Undo/Redo in SketchLoom — from Priya to Dario. The undo stack in the diagram editor is command-based, not snapshot-based, so every mutation must register an inverse operation. Watch for grouped edits: they push a composite command, and redo replays children in order. New folks often miss that canvas pans are deliberately excluded from history. Stack depth, debounce windows, and persistence behavior are all driven by the service config. The current values we run in staging are as follows.

deployment values, yadup-kadug:
[sorys]
port = 5672
team = noveth
host = sorys.orvexcorp.example
region = south-4
access_code = ac_deddc1
timeout_ms = 1500

Step 6 — Sign the GarageSense occupancy feed bundle

Before publishing the parking-garage occupancy feed service, verify the manifest checksum matches the build log from the Lanternworks CI run. Do not skip this even for patch releases, as downstream kiosks cache unsigned bundles aggressively. Once the checksum matches, sign the bundle on the release host using the deploy key below.

rollout seal: bky4_DFM9

## 3.2.0 — Changed defaults

Telemetry payloads from the Harkline agents are now compressed with zstd by default rather than shipped raw. During canary testing on the Dunmore fleet this cut egress volume by roughly 62% with no measurable CPU regression on collector nodes. Operators who pinned the old behavior must now opt out explicitly. Release managers should confirm downstream ingestors accept compressed frames before promoting. The new shipped defaults are listed below.

settings of fafog-haduf:
ZORIX_PIN=4648
ZORIX_METRICS_HOST=metrics.zorix.paliqsys.corp
ZORIX_LOG_LEVEL=info
ZORIX_TENANT=druix